Hi there! I used to work in a chinese restaurant back in my college days. 10 packs of 5 litres wine for 30 tables are way too much man. Usually they serve about 4-5 packs of 5 litres wine only. biggrin.gif

Because there are only a few wine drinkers (average 2-3 only) in a single table.
